You can travel along the winding roads of the Dordogne to discover some of the most beautiful villages of France (Beynac, la Roque Gageac, Castelnaud la Chapelle, Domme, etc.). Périgord is also steeped in history: nearby, visit the caves (Cougnac, Font de Gaumes, Maxange, etc.), gardens (Marqueyssac, Eyrignac, etc.), castles (Castelnaud, Beynac, les Milandes, Reignac fortified house, etc.), not forgetting the chasms (Padirac and Proumeyssac). Périgord is also known for its gastronomy: foie gras, duck and goose confit and breast, and walnut cakes, a real treat for the taste buds.
